The original port was done by B. Korz and crew on Zeta. I tested the game on BeOS, and it behaves as expected, except no networking (for multiplayer). I then tested it on Haiku. There's three issues: 1) The binary can't be executed unless it's from a terminal (yes, the permissions are correct). On BeOS, it's no problem. 2) Having your monitor set to the default resolution for Wesnoth (1024x768), the game starts in full screen under Haiku, but then kicks back to windowed mode (under BeOS it stays in full). When you uncheck toggle fullscreen in the video preferences, it goes back to fullscreen, but it's pitch black. 3) Networking doesn't work, yet the errors are different. Under BeOS, the error will be 'Could not connect to host' no matter what you try, whereas under Haiku the error is 'Illegal character in compression input' - see attached. The game, v1.2.1, can be found here: [http://www.haikuware.com/view-details/games/strategy/wesnoth12] Please read the specific instructions under the file's description to start the game. Currently you have to put a comment of false under full screen in the preferences file it creates in order to play it properly.
